All answers beginning with 'J':
1)adj. pertaining to the neck.
2)n. a woman whose ugliness by conventional standards is part of her charm. (Fr phrase).
3)adj. full of jokes: facetious: merry.
4)adj. empty: spiritless, meagre, arid: showing lack of information or experience: naïve, immature, callow.
5)n. a joining: a union: a critical or important point in time.
6)adj. according to sound judgment: possessing sound judgment: discreet.
Bonus: adj. becoming youthful.

All answers beginning with 'K':
1)n. a would-be musical instrument, a tube with a strip of cat-gut, etc., that resonates to the voice.
2)adj. dust-coloured, dull brownish or greenish yellow. (Urdu & Pers.)
3)n. a child in thieves’ slang.
4)n. the unopened bud of a flower: an architectural ornament resembling that. (Ger.)
5)n. credit, fame, renown, prestige.
6)n. a castle or fortress in a N.African town or the area round it, esp. in Algiers (has an alternative spelling beginning with ‘c’).
B: n. government by the worst.
